Over the last decade, a food innovation community has been established in Boston’s greater startup and tech ecosystem. Think of ezCater, which was founded in 2007 and it's now a nationwide marketplace for corporate catering. Think of Toast, which raised a total of $134 million for its restaurant point of sale and management system. Think of our very own Drizly, aka "Amazon for liquor," which started when two Boston College students were curious why they couldn't get beer delivered via app.

But the story doesn't end here. In Boston, food startups have the resources and the access to talent to thrive. BostInno has compiled a list of the early-stage food tech companies you need to know right now.
